What is Million Marker?

Million Marker is a lifestyle tracker designed to help you identify and reduce everyday toxic chemical exposures. It works by tracking your diet and product use to provide personalized reports and recommendations for a healthier lifestyle.

How does Million Marker help reduce toxic exposures?

By documenting your diet and product usage, Million Marker pinpoints specific chemicals like BPA and phthalates you may be exposed to. It then offers tailored advice on product swaps and habit changes to minimize these exposures.

Can Million Marker be used with a test kit?

Yes, when used in conjunction with the Million Marker Test Kit, the app provides a comprehensive lifestyle audit of chemical exposures. This combination offers a deeper understanding and more precise recommendations for detoxifying your life.

What types of toxic chemicals does Million Marker track?

The app focuses on common everyday toxic chemicals found in personal care products, foods, drinks, food storage, and plastics. These include chemicals such as bisphenol A (BPA), phthalates, parabens, and triclosan, which are linked to various chronic diseases.

Is Million Marker suitable for families or those planning families?

Yes, Million Marker is particularly beneficial for people hoping to expand their families, as toxic chemical exposures can impact fertility and fetal development. The app provides insights to help safeguard family health.
